its rare that i completely dis-agree with others comments on this forum but on this occasion i do.. pressed plates i admit can be a grey area and certain pressed plates and fonts are illegal which would result in a fine if found running them on your car, however Legal pressed plates are available..the difference being they are pressed with a uk font and also stamped with the ba5u mark making them legal. i paid £35 for mine from regal who supply them on behalf of dubmeister, ive run them for best part of two years and never had a problem. just my 2p..
